What is 399Apps' refund and cancellation policy?

Short answer

399Apps is billed monthly at a flat ₹399/month per app — there is no annual contract to lock you in. Cancel before your next monthly billing date and the charges stop; your data stays exportable. A 14-day free trial with no credit card required lets you test the full product before paying, so the cancellation question almost never arises.

Monthly billing: no annual contract to trap you

The most common cancellation trap in Indian billing software is the annual plan: you pay upfront for a year, discover the software is missing a key feature or the support is poor, and then find yourself in a 7-day refund window that already closed. Vyapar and myBillBook both offer refunds only within 7 days of purchase, and only on annual base subscriptions — renewals are typically non-refundable. Zoho Books gives credits rather than cash refunds if you downgrade mid-year.

399Apps does not use annual billing. You pay ₹399/month per app, month to month. If you cancel before your next billing date, the charges stop. The most exposure you have is one month's fee — not twelve. There is no minimum term, no cancellation fee, and no requirement to call a helpline to cancel.

What happens to your data when you cancel

This is the real fear behind the refund question: "if I cancel, do I lose all my invoices and business records?" The answer is no. Your data remains exportable after cancellation — parties, items, invoice history, ledgers, trial balance and GST reports can all be downloaded to Excel, CSV or PDF. There is no sudden access cutoff on the day your subscription lapses.

Contrast this with Zoho Books, which moves your account to read-only mode the moment the subscription ends — you can view data but cannot export transactions without resubscribing. With 399Apps, the safe practice is to export a fresh copy of your key reports before cancelling, which takes a few minutes. For full control, self-hosting lets you keep the database on your own server, entirely independent of any subscription.

Can I cancel my 399Apps subscription anytime? +
Yes. Cancel before your next monthly billing date and the charges stop. There is no minimum term, no cancellation fee, and no annual contract. Contact support by email to cancel.
Is there an annual contract or lock-in with 399Apps? +
No. 399Apps is billed monthly — ₹399/month per app. You are never committed to a full year upfront. Most competing billing software (Vyapar, myBillBook) defaults to annual billing, which means a longer refund exposure window.
What happens to my data if I cancel my 399Apps subscription? +
Your data stays exportable — parties, items, invoices, ledgers, trial balance and GST reports can be downloaded to Excel, CSV or PDF even after cancellation. There is no sudden access cutoff. Export a fresh copy of your key records before cancelling as a safe habit.
Is there a free trial before I have to pay? +
Yes. A 14-day free trial is available through the contact form at 399apps.com/contact — no credit card required. You get full access to the product so you can test GST invoicing, inventory and accounting before paying.
Will 399Apps auto-renew without asking me? +
Monthly subscriptions renew month to month — you will be charged each month until you cancel. There is no surprise annual auto-renewal that locks you in for a year. Cancel before your next billing date and no further charges are made.
What if I want a refund after paying for a month? +
Because 399Apps is monthly, the most you have paid is one month's fee. Refund requests are considered on a case-by-case basis — contact support. The better path is to use the 14-day free trial before subscribing, so you know the software fits before the first payment.
Why does Vyapar / myBillBook have a 7-day refund policy but 399Apps does not? +
Vyapar and myBillBook charge annually upfront, so they have a 7-day window to cover early buyer's remorse. 399Apps charges monthly, so a 7-day window would be almost the entire billing period anyway — the safer design is monthly billing from day one, combined with a 14-day free trial before you pay anything.
